<p><br>
On Feb 1, 2012 10:48 AM, "Michael Richter" <<a href="mailto:ttmrichter@gmail.com">ttmrichter@gmail.com</a>> wrote:<br>
><br>
> Code is:</p>
<p>> A = (func(K, X1, X2, X3, X4, X5) =<br>
>                   (B = ((func) = apply(A, K - 1, B, X1, X2, X3, X4))),<br>
>                   (K =< 0 -><br>
>                         apply(X4) + apply(X5)<br>
>                   ;<br>
>                         apply(B)<br>
>                   )<br>
>             ),</p>
<p>to make the problem clearer, you have here</p>
<p>  A = (func(X) = B, C),</p>
<p>How is this not like your definitions of named functions?<br></p>
<p>Cheers,<br>
Julian</p>